Who was Nelson Mandela???<br>No spam.​
Rama09 [41]

Answer:

Nelson Rolihlahla Mandela was a South African anti-apartheid revolutionary, political leader and philanthropist who served as the first president of South Africa from 1994 to 1999. He was the country's first black head of state and the first elected in a fully representative democratic election

Professor Jones believes that drinking 5 glasses of milk a day will make one grow. He has ten 6-year-old children drink 5 glasse
Aleks04 [339]

Question:

What is the Independent Variable

2. What is the Dependent Variable

3. What is the Potential Confounding Variable

Answer:

1.  5 glasses of Milk

2.  Growth.

3.  5 glasses of Orange Juice

Explanation:

The Independent variable is a term in a research study, which describes a variable whose variation does not hinge on another variable. Hence, in this case, the independent variable is 5 glasses of Milk

The dependent variable on the other hand is a form of the variable under test and assessed in an experiment. This form of the variable depends on the independent variable. Hence, in this case, the Dependent Variable is Growth

While Potential Confounding Variable is a form of a variable that has an external impact that changes the outcome of a dependent and independent variable. Here, the potential confounding variable is 5 glasses of Orange Juice.
